Who would you guys take here. Zinter or Murphy. Zinter for me. G is a bigger need than DT as long as they are about equal in terms of BPA. Guessing the are about equal since one expert took one and one took the other.

https://www.fieldgulls.com/2024/4/15/24 ... y-nfl-news
if not mistaken, Zinter way farther down the board because of injury, no? Had heard that before that he was considered a first round talent though.
But the scouting report i read says his mobility is a weakness and he struggles if asked to pull - that is NOT a fit in the Grubb and Huff offense, as opposed to several other guys who are (Barton, Fautanu, JPJ, Haynes, Mahogany, Puni, McCormick, Beebe, Coleman, Rosengarten, Amenidje).

as for murphy, would want to trade down, not thrilled with stick and pick him at 16.
